    INSEAD (/ ɪ n s iː æ d / IN-see-ad), [5] a contraction of "Institut Européen d'Administration des Affaires" (lit. ' European Institute of Business Administration '), [6] is a non-profit graduate business school that maintains campuses in France (Europe Campus), Singapore (Asia Campus), and the United Arab Emirates (Middle East Campus).
